Industry Overview

The refined governance of a digital city involves three major safety networks. In addition to the well-known ground and low-altitude supervision networks, there is also anunderground lifelinethat is often overlooked but crucial to urban safetyurban underground pipeline networks (such as those for gas, drainage, and sewage). These are concentrated areas of underground hazardous and explosive gases. The confined spaces in these pipe networks are highly prone to the accumulation of gases such as methane, hydrogen sulfide, and ammonia. Once the concentration exceeds the standard or a leak occurs, it may trigger accidents such as gas poisoning and explosions, endangering lives.

Industry Requirements

In response to the above situation, a well-known solution provider has jointly developed an underground hazard source AI control robot (hereinafter referred to as therobot”) with TouchThink. The robot uses sensors to collect liquid levels in underground pipe networks and sewage pools, as well as the concentration of toxic and harmful gases. It then displays real-time monitoring and disposal status through a TouchThink All-in-One PC. When anomalies occur, the TouchThink All-in-One PC can assume automatic control functions, triggering over-limit alarms, activating fresh air circulation, and ozone disinfection disposal systems until the anomalies are resolved.

During this process, the TouchThink industrial all-in-one PC needs to meet the client’s stringent requirements for hardware performance and be capable of addressing the environmental challenges of the robot’s outdoor operations.

  • Local Data Processing and Prediction Model Operation: It must have built-in computing power to run local data processing and prediction models, enabling pre-judgment of risks.
  • High-Speed Network Support: It requires high-speed network capabilities to support remote mobile control and cloud-based supervision.
  • Environmental Resistance:Withstand outdoor extreme temperatures, strong light, ultraviolet rays, rain, and other factors that may affect the visibility and touch effect of the all-in-one PC.
  • 24/7 Continuous Operation: Be able to handle the challenge of round-the-clock uninterrupted operation.

24-hour continuous operation with stable and low power consumption

In this case, TPC-W28 is equipped with Intel® Celeron® J1900, 4 cores/4 threads, with a thermal design power consumption (TDP) of only 10W. With a fanless design, it ensures the balance between computing power requirements and power consumption, can automatically handle abnormal information, and fully meets the robot’s needs for all-weather monitoring and operation.

TPC-W28 also supports optional Intel® J4125, J6412 and Core i3/i5/i7 processors to adapt to richer application scenarios and performance requirements.

High brightness and wide temperature range: ensuring uninterrupted outdoor interaction

Aiming at the outdoor operation characteristics of the robot, TouchThink has upgraded the device with a 1000nits high-brightness screen and added waterproof rubber strips. This ensures clear visibility even under direct sunlight. Combined with an IP65-protected panel, enclosed body design, and three-proof coating protection on the motherboard, it has passed strict dustproof and waterproof tests, enabling stable operation in rainy days and sandy environments.

The TPC-W28 supports 10-point capacitive touch and operation with wet hands or gloves. It adapts to a wide temperature range of -10°C to 60°C and can be upgraded with full lamination, heat-insulating UV protection, and anti-reflective coating coverage as needed. In practice, it has demonstrated no aging, no black screens, and no condensation, truly achieving reliable and uninterrupted outdoor interaction.

High-Speed Networking for Unattended Operations and Remote Control

The TPC-W28 integrates 4G/WiFi and dual Gigabit Ethernet communications, with abundant pre-installed I/O interfaces. It supports RS485 connectivity to PLCs and intelligent gateways, enabling the aggregation of underground sensor data. The device can interface with remote management systems such as mobile terminal apps and cloud platforms to achieve millisecond-level monitoring, early warning, and processing of anomalies. This reduces the frequency of manual inspections and on-site operations, providing real-time safety guarantees for the unattended management of underground pipeline networks.
